Story Background : The story is set against the backdrop of the original Kasamh Se, taking on from the point where Jai and Bani are separated after the Park Road Raaz comes out and she loses her child during the murderous attack, when she tries to protect Jai’s life. Most of the characters remain the same as in the show, except that Raashi is married to Saahil and Rano and Ranveer are still single. Pia and Pushkar are seperated, and nothing has happened between Pia and Jai. Also, I haven’t gone into details of who tries to kill JW and ends up harming Bani instead…all that is just mentioned in passing. JW has come to know the truth about Bani’s miscarriage while she is still in the hospital. Now read on…
Part I A
For some strange, unexplained reason, Jai remembered the story of snow-white and the seven dwarfs. The particular scene that had caused him to cry out loud in the auditorium of his primary school, where Snow-white lay on her bed, pale and calm…as silent as the night.
Today, more than 35 years later, he could visualize the same scene again…when he saw Bani lying with the same chilling silence on the hospital bed, swathed in white robes and surrounded by what looked like a thousand medical apparatus. It was only till Massi’s comforting hand touched his shoulders, which made Jai to come to his own.
One look at Massi’s face and all the anguish and pain that had buried itself in Jai’s heart seemed to burst open like a dam and he broke down crying.
‘Munna...don’t cry like that. Don’t do that Jai…please…if you break into pieces, who will comfort her?’
Still sobbing, Jai replied back in a choked voice, ‘What comfort can I give her Massi? Its all because of me…I have given her nothing but my hatred and anger…and if she is here today, its only for me.’
Massi stood watching Jai dissolving in his guilt and pain and unable to hold herself back, she too broke down crying. ‘Beta, don’t blame yourself like that…it’s not your fault…just as it wasn’t Bani’s…it’s…its just destiny.’
Jai had stopped crying and repeated in an absent voice, ‘Yes, its destiny…I never believed in it…but now that I look back…it is the only explanation I have, for all that happened…the good and the bad.’
Massi patted Jai’s hair and spoke comfortingly, ‘Nothing is lost Jai…the Doctor has said that there is hope…and now, you know the truth also…lets just leave everything upon God to set things right once again.’
Jai sat in silence, lost in his thoughts, till Rano who had been standing in a corner, overhearing the conversation, came near him and kneeled in front of Jai. ‘Yes Jeejaji…nothing is lost…and I know that you and Bani di are just meant to be…Life will give you another chance.’
Jai looked at his youngest sister-in-law, who had tears in her eyes but a faint yet reassuring smile on her face and Massi, always optimistic and positive added, ‘And when life gives you and Bani that another chance, make sure that you grab it with both your hands and never let it go again.’
Part I B
‘She is out of danger, Mr. Walia.’
No other words could have given more peace to Jai than the ones just uttered by Dr. Mathur. He sat in stillness, waiting for the doctor to say something more, still anxious and terrified about his wife’s condition, not still fully believing that she was now going to live.
Dr. Mathur looked at Jai’s pale, drawn out face, his eyes had sunken, his cheekbones looked protruded and he looked like he could collapse just any moment. Clearing her throat, she said in a slightly light-hearted vein, ‘Your wife is on recovery, but you look like a wreck, Mr. Walia.’
Jai looked up at the Doctor and she spoke in a comforting tone, ‘I know you have been under grave mental distress…but if you ruin your health in this manner, who will take care of her…I hope you understand that she has literally come back from her own death…and it will take a long time for her to heal…physically and emotionally.’
Jai spoke, his deep voice, gravelly and pleading, ‘Can…Can I see her?’
Dr. Mathur took off her glasses and after a few moment’s silence spoke softly, ‘I…I am not sure, Mr. Walia. After all that you told me…regarding what happened between you and your wife…the manner in which it happened…she is in deep trauma…and has just begun responding to the medication…but is still in an emotional limbo…I am not sure, how she will react to your presence right away.’
Jai felt his broken heart shattering into further pieces on hearing this, but bracing up, he answered back, ‘I understand…I will just look at her from outside the ICU…but…will you tell me if she asks about me?’
Dr. Mathur was so touched by Jai’s pain and anguish over Bani, that she felt her eyes smarting and immediately summoned herself up to not get emotional about a patient’s personal life. In her best professional tones, she replied back, ‘Of course. And please don’t lose heart…everything will fall in the right place…just give it some time.’
Part I C
A sharp spasm of pain ran through Bani’s entire body, the moment she regained consciousness. Such was the intensity of pain in her lower abdomen that a cry escaped her bruised lips and tears came out involuntarily.
Rano who had fallen asleep, woke up with a startle and gasped when she saw Bani’s eyes open. ‘Di…’ she whispered, coming near her sister, holding on to her cold, frail fingers, finding it impossible to hold back her tears at seeing her sister’s condition, yet happiness filled her heart, at having Bani react for the first time in the last fifteen days since she had been brought to the hospital in a physically battered state.
Bani blinked her eyes and tried to focus on the voice and a faint smile came on to her face, when she recognized her youngest sister. Both of them looked at each other in silence, till Rano could hold no more and broke down crying copiously, keeping her head on the pillow on which Bani was resting.
Next Morning
Bani had been propped up a pillow and between Raashi and Rano, was getting a breakfast of apple juice poured into her mouth by spoonful.
Raashi tenderly wiped the stray drops that came onto to her lips and smiled warmly at Bani. ‘Are you feeling better than yesterday, Mamiji?’
Bani did not reply back but just kept sitting, expressionless. Both Rano and Raashi exchanged a look, indicating that it was still early days for them to expect any normal conversation from Bani.
They had just finished giving breakfast when Massi and Aditya came along. Aditya smiled warmly and spoke, ‘We are so happy that you are alright Bani…and that you are with your family again.’ Massi came near her, tears filling her eyes and planting a light kiss on Bani’s bandaged forehead, echoed the same sentiments.
By the time it was afternoon, Bani felt exhausted by the stream of visitors who had been coming. Pushkar had come alongside his family, followed by Nachiket who had actually ended up making Bani smile with his jokes and anecdotes. Ranveer had visited along with Saahil and Jigyasa, who looked wrought with guilt and concern over Bani’s state. The last person to come had been Pia, looking so heartbroken and so shaken, that even Rano had felt bad for her, considering that she had not been on speaking terms with Pia for a very long time now.
With the visiting hours over, the nurse had come and given medicines to Bani and put her off to sleep and in the silence of her room, Bani ended up crying for a long time over the one person whom she had been so desperate to see, but had not shown up till now. Maybe she deserved it…after all hadn’t she lost his most cherished dream because of her stubbornness and carelessness. Running her bruise laden hand over the empty stomach, Bani found it impossible to stop the stream of tears that seemed to have become her destiny now.
It was close to midnight, when Bani stirred slightly in her sleep. Maybe it was the effect of the sedatives and tranquilizers or the black memories of that gruesome assault on her that disturbed her sleep so badly. But she felt as if there was someone in the room…someone who was looking at her. Despite her best efforts, Bani found it impossible to open her eyes and focus in the darkness…but she could sense a definite presence…and strangely it did not make her feel afraid…rather it comforted her…made her desperate to open her eyes and see who that presence was.
When Bani awoke the next morning, she could see Rano standing nearby; measuring out the medicines that had to be given to Bani and Raashi was just entering the room getting breakfast for her from home. Nothing seemed unusual, till Bani turned her head to see a huge bouquet of white lilies placed on a vase besides her bed. She kept staring at the flowers, which looked slightly wilted, as if they had stayed a full night in the vase before the morning…a strange feeling escaped Bani…someone had been in the room last night…and there was just one person in the whole world who could have remembered that White Lilies were her favorite flowers.
Gasping for breath, Bani whispered in a broken, hoary voice, ‘Mr. Walia…was he there in this room?’ Rano and Raashi were so stunned by the fact that Bani had uttered her first words after coming out of the Coma, that they kept staring blankly at her for several moments, till Rano gushed in happiness, ‘Di…you spoke? I can’t believe this…wait till I tell Massi…and of course Dr. Mathur should be informed…and Pushkar will be so happy…and Nachiket will come running right now with Ranveer and Aditya Uncle…’
In the excitement pervading, Bani lost sense of what she wanted to ask and was stunned into silence again, staring at those wilted flowers…which still carried the deep, intense scene that distinguishes white lilies.
Part I D
1 Month Later
Jai had finished packing his suitcase and was putting his personal belongings in a separate bag, when Massi and Aditya entered his room.
‘Munna, why are you doing this? Now when everything has been set right…and Bani is coming back home…why are you leaving this house?’ Jai looked at Massi and Aditya’s anguished face and spoke quietly, ‘She has just recovered physically from that incident…but is completely broken down…seeing me would only remind her of that past more and more…its best that I stay away from her for as long as she takes to recover…and only when she asks for me, shall I come back.’
Jigyasa had come from behind and she said, both angry and sad, ‘Jai Bhaiyya, this is your house…why do you have to leave it?’ Jai stared at his sister and such was the reigned in fury in them, that Jigyasa shuddered and moved behind Aditya, as if for support against her brother’s anger.
‘If only you had shown this concern and this affection for me earlier on, Jigyasa…a lot of things that happened would have never happened in the first place…’ Looking at the hurt on Jigyasa face at his words, Jai spoke in a softer yet defeated tone, ‘Yet, there is no one to blame but me…My marriage and my wife were my responsibility and I failed them both miserably…so if anyone has to live with regret and pain, then its only me.’
Saying that Jai called Tony to take his packed belongings to the Car and he drove off to his empty apartment which was some distance away from Walia Mansion.
Two days Later
Pushkar held Bani’s hands and spoke with warmth and tenderness, ‘Bani, even though Pia and I are not together anymore, I hope that truth never come between our relationship…our friendship…and that is why I want you to know that you can come and stay with us anytime you want…if you don’t want to go back to Walia Mansion, I can…’
Bani smiled back at Pushkar and spoke with some effort, ‘I know that you care for me Pushkar…and that you will always be there for me…but I want to go back to my home…’
Pushkar patted her cheeks gingerly and smilingly added, ‘I can’t tell you how happy I am to hear that…besides, you know what a terrible cook Seema Bhabh is…’
Bani broke out laughing gently, joined in by Pushkar who continued regaling her with some more light-hearted words.
Jai stood outside the door watching both of them…till he felt too heartbroken to see Bani and not able to be near her, that he turned and stormed out of the hospital building, going straight inside his Car and keeping his head on the steering wheel, smarted under the tears of desperation and longing-ness that he felt for Bani.
Part I E
Walia Mansion
Bani was overcome by the love, affection and care that was lavished upon her, the moment she set her foot upon her married home. No one seemed to leave her without attendance for even a few minutes…be it Raashi’s labored ministrations over Bani’s food or Rano giving her medicines on the dot of time…or Massi reading out the Ramayan for her every morning or Dadi and Aditya cheering up Bani with their jovial talk. Nachiket never forgot to get fresh flowers for her daily to be placed by her bedside and even the usually reserved Ranveer, came and sat with Bani every evening after he came home from Office. Only Jigyasa and Saahil seemed to ignore her, but even they refrained from any of their usual rudeness or coldness towards Bani, just staying out of her room.
Bani responded to the medication and to the attention and love of her family faster than what Dr. Mathur had anticipated.
But an unfathomably deep pain lingered in Bani’s heart…it was more than a month since she was brutally attacked, thereby losing the child in her womb and getting grievously injured. Where was Jai? Why hadn’t he come to visit her even once? Why wasn’t anyone talking about him? Why couldn’t she see him at home or even hear his voice?
The only reason that Bani could think of was that Jai was extremely angry and broken up by the death of their child…and held her responsible. Hadn’t he kept begging her for the last few months of her pregnancy to take care of herself? Hadn’t he literally gone on his knees asking her not to risk the child’s life by staying all alone? Hadn’t he asked for her forgiveness over her mother’s death innumerable times, pleading her not to bargain their child’s future over what happened in the past?
And today, his deepest fear, his biggest apprehension, his greatest letdown had come true…Bani had lost the child that had been Jai’s dream and no one else, but she was responsible.
It was too late to give explanations…to tell Jai that she had long forgiven and forgotten about what happened 7 years back with her Mother…that the reason for her separation from Jai was something much more serious…that she had no go but to be blackmailed because his life was at stake…that she couldn’t tell him the truth because the very people who he loved and trusted were backstabbing him…that she had no other way out but to put her life to risk to save his.
Tears filled up her beautiful eyes…Jai had once told her that her eyes had the color of an autumn evening…and that they spoke everything that she couldn’t manage with words. Bani wondered why anyone would want to fall in love if it hurt so badly. Every memory about their short-lived marriage brought out such spasms of deep pain, that she wanted to cry her heart out for Jai. Even in those precious few months of her marriage, Bani had found the promise of a lifetime of love and affection from her husband…the man whom she worshipped before god…the man who had started filling the palette of her life with every possible color…and when she had begun seeing the love she had for him in his eyes too…destiny had played a cruel hand and everything had fallen apart…so much so that Bani did not even know where to look and start collecting the fragments of her broken life.
Part I F
Walia Industries
It was almost the fifth time that one of Aditya, Ranveer and Tarun had to fill in for Jai, as the client volleyed questions after questions. Jai was just physically present in the board room but it was evident that he was completely clueless about what was going on.
A look passed between the trio and Aditya, taking the lead as the senior director of Walia Industries, addressed the client, ‘So Mr. McWilliams, I hope we have resolved all the main issues…and if there are any minor details to be discussed, I propose you sort them over Lunch with our senior management executives, Ranveer Bali and Nachiket Walia.’
Before the very unhappy Mr. McWilliams could offer a protest, Ranveer and Nachiket very deftly ushered him out of the board room and took him for a business lunch.
Tarun looked on to Jai, who had his chin placed on his folded palms and was staring at his laptop, completely unaware of his surrounding. Adtiya looked on too and spoke gently yet with a tinge of frustration, ‘Jai…what is this? You called the McWilliams chap for a one to one meeting and didn’t answer even one of his questions…he looked furious…I wonder how those two boys are going to handle him…’
Getting no response from Jai, Aditya shook his head and indicated towards Tarun to say something. ‘Jai…Jai…are you even present in this room?’
ai looked blankly at his best friend and company lawyer and spoke almost nostalgically, ‘Bani came to this very board room on her first day in this office…I was in a meeting with my board of directors…Adi, do you remember? And when I saw her interrupting the presentation, I shouted so loudly, that the cup of coffee she had been holding for me fell from her hands…and she stood there shivering, tears filling in those beautiful eyes…till Pushkar went and gave her a tissue paper and helped her out of the room…I came to know later on that Gloria had asked her to get some coffee for me and that she had ended up burning her hands with the hot liquid…I had felt bad…but never bothered to apologize.’
Aditya felt so emotional on hearing the words, that he covered his face in the palms of his hands, feeling distraught at his friend’s mental state and Tarun looked extremely worried. Taking lead, Tarun spoke calmly, ‘Jai, stop doing this to yourself. For god sake, just look at you…work can be managed…we are all there…but please get a grip on yourself…and stop this self-punishment.’
Aditya looked up at his brother-in-law and added, ‘Tarun is right; Jai…stop blaming yourself for all that happened…what could you have done about it? It was just an unfortunate, unwanted accident…’
Suddenly getting agitated, Jai banged on the table and almost shouted out in a hoarse voice, choked with emotion, ‘I am her husband, Adi…I vowed to protect her…to take care of her…to always be with her…and when she wanted me the most…I wasn’t there…did you see her in that hospital bed? Did you see her Tarun? Did you see soaked in blood and writhing in unimaginable pain? Where was I then? Where was I when she was hit mercilessly by those bastards who wanted to kill me? Where was I when she was blackmailed into silence to protect my life? Where was I when she put her life into risk only so that nothing would happen to me?’
Stunned into silence, Tarun and Aditya stared on to Jai’s flushed face and blood red eyes and he spoke with ominous chill, ‘Every breath that I am taking now is a gift from her…a gift for which she had to put herself through a lifetime of pain and grief…how do you think I am going to continue living with the same life that she has given me?’
Saying that, Jai stormed off, leaving an aghast and shocked Tarun and Aditya speechless.
Walia Mansion
Raashi had helped change Bani into a Sari, something she was wearing after a very long gap. She had expressed her desire to wear one and Raashi had been so happy to see Bani expressing a wish, that she had immediately taken out Bani’s entire wardrobe and chosen the prettiest Sari in it.
‘There goes the gold chain in your neck…and Mamiji, I envy you so much for looking this beautiful…even though according to Dr. Mathur, you are anemic right now.’
Bani laughed alongside Raashi and was later joined in by Rano who announced that Tarun had come to meet her and could she get him to her room. Tarun came holding a huge bouquet of white lilies inside the room and before she could react, lurching forward dramatically, planted a light kiss on both her cheeks and said in all seriousness, ‘Please marry me, Bani!’
Seeing the look of utter shock in Bani, Raashi and Rano’s faces, he took a few steps back and putting his hands up said, ‘This is also called a joke in some cultures…and if any of you are going to slap me, I will take it in very good spirits.’
Bani found herself laughing uncontrollably for the next one hour, thoroughly embarrassed yet amused by Tarun’s outrageous flirting and jokes. In between, Tarun remarked, ‘Yaar, don’t laugh so much...I don’t want any of your surgical suchers falling off with all that laughing. Jai will hunt me down and cut me into pieces if anything happens to you.’
At the mention of his name, Bani’s expression immediately altered and a look of such yearning and love came over her eyes that Tarun felt intensely moved and spoke softly, ‘I take it from that look on your face that you miss him a lot…’
Bani did not answer but lowered her face so that Tarun couldn’t see the fast forming tears in her eyes. Keeping a steady hand over her own frail ones, he said emphatically, ‘You both are so different from each other…yet like mirror images…Jai would rather drown himself in his grief and all that alcohol he drinks than come and face you…and you would rather sit alone in this room and wallow in anguish & tears than ask someone for him. What is the problem with both of you?’
Bani had started sobbing quietly, unable to hold herself anymore, while Tarun lifted her face and looking into her said, ‘Bani…I can’t see my friend in this state anymore…he is killing himself…all he wants in this world is to be with you and please correct me if I am wrong, but I can sense something very similar with you also.’
‘Then why hasn’t he come even once to see me?’ Bani was now sobbing heavily, burying her face in the palms of her hand. Hearing the commotion, the others had come rushing to and were a witness to the conversation.
Tarun spoke unheeded, ‘I don’t know exactly why he hasn’t come to see you…but all that he can think of 24 by 7 is Bani, Bani and only Bani. His coming to the office is a mere formality…all he does is open his laptop and stare at your pictures…if I go to his apartment, either he is drunk senseless and uttering your name…or locked himself in a room for hours on end without any food or water…he responds to nothing and no one, but even a blind man can see that Jai badly needs you, Bani…’
Looking at her stunned face, Tarun continued in a gentler tone, ‘And please…before he ends up killing himself, either intentionally or accidentally…just go and bring him back to this world.’
Taking leave, Tarun smiled and said, ‘Jai has always been an obstinate man and sometimes acted foolishly too…and now such is his state, that he has become an obstinate fool who is desperately and dangerously in love…and since you are the sole reason of his fanatical obsession…no one else but you can get him back to his senses!’
Everyone took leave one after the other, till only Massi was left and asking the a reluctant Rano and Raashi to take leave, she closed the door from behind and came near Bani, who still sat stunned and numb on the bed, after hearing all that Tarun had just told her.
‘Massi…all that Tarunji just said…but…I thought he hated me…I lost his child…how can…’ Bani spoke, incoherently, not able to complete her words.
Massi patted her soft hair and spoke in gentle tones, ‘Ask your heart, Bani…did it convince you even once that Jai can hate you? That a man who put across all his misgivings, all his apprehensions, all his prejudices just for your happiness, could have the capacity to detest you?’
Taking in her tear strained face, Massi smiled through her own tears and said, ‘I admit that Jai has never once told me whether he loves you or not…but whenever I looked into his eyes, all I could see was immeasurable love for you, Bani…a love so deep, a love so pure, that no words or expression’s in the world could have the strength to carry them.’
Bani broke down crying on Massi’s shoulders who consoled her, ‘Nahin beta…don’t shed those tears…for what are you crying? You both are blessed to be loved with such depth and with such conviction…even when Jai is away from you, his love lives within you, just as yours lives with him…the fact that you long endlessly for Jai and he lives every moment for you is a living proof of your love. What else do you need to convince yourself of Bani?’
Part I G
Jai’s apartment
Despite remonstrations and apprehensions from Massi, Bani left Walia House when it was close to 9 Pm, making her promise that no one in the house will come to know of her absence. Though Tony looked very anxious at the fact that he was driving Bani away from home at this hour and that too when she had just started recovering her health, he could not refuse or even object, when she told him the address to where she wanted to go. Tony would have defied the Holy Orders when it came to doing anything for Jai’s sake.
‘Madam, 25th floor…Penthouse Suit D. Please give me a missed call when you want to drive back home…I will be waiting for you in the Car.’ Tony spoke respectfully, after dropping her at the Nariman Point Condominium where Jai was living now. Just as Tony closed the door of the Car after helping her come out, he said, trying to hide his smile, ‘If Jai sir is not at home, you can enter the apartment using his personal lock code…’
Bani turned to look at Tony, a bit puzzled and he explained quickly, albeit a bit embarrassed, ‘Er…sometimes, he is still asleep when I come in the morning to clear the apartment and make his breakfast…so he gave me that code to enter, incase he doesn’t respond to the doorbell.’
Bani correctly guessed that Tony was referring to Jai’s drunken inebriations which would probably explain his sleeping till late in the morning, something that Jai had never done in the past. She felt intensely saddened at Jai’s state and found herself desperately seeking to see him immediately, praying that he would be in.
‘What is the code?’ she asked softly.
Tony answered in the best possible professional tone, ‘B-A-N-I.’
A visibly stunned Bani colored immediately and without waiting to say anything more, walked towards the security gates of Jai’s building. The walk from the main gate till the elevator and the ride up seemed to increase Bani’s heartbeat rapidly and she kept twisting the edge of her sari and suddenly realized that she was wearing the same sari that Jai had gifted her a few months back.
‘The last door in the corridor, Madam. Mr. Walia’s apartment.’ Bani gave a nervous smile at the doorman who had accompanied her, since the elevator to the Penthouse Suits were exclusively only for the residents. Bowing very cordially to her, the doorman went down again, leaving Bani standing in front of Penthouse Suit D.
She found her hands trembling as they went up to press the doorbell and stayed on it, unmoved. She stood for sometime, beads of nervous sweat appearing on her face…more than 2 months had passed that she had last seen Jai…when he had thundered with anger…furious at the fact that she had taken on a job, despite the Doctor’s strict advice for bed-rest…how she had argued with him…answered him back…hurt him with her coldness…all that came back hauntingly to Bani and she found herself crying.
Bani was caught between the urge to go down again and rush back home, to hide herself in that guest room where she was staying and cry her heart out…she felt her courage giving way and even though all she wanted was to see Jai just once…somehow she became motionless.
It was only when she heard the sound of the elevator coming up again, that she panicked and in a frenzy, typed her name on the key-pad, clicking the door open. Pushing the heavy, chromium handle back, she entered the huge expanse of the apartment and stood stunned.
Even in the dim lights that gave the apartment an eerily glow, she could see scores and scores of her pictures on the wall…on the desk…on the coffee table…Bani stood staring at them…she didn’t even know when some of the pictures had been clicked. She could see one of her earliest, when she had just joined Walia Industries and had got a picture clicked for record in the HR Department…there was one from a group picnic…with a dimutive Bani standing far across from her then boss, Jai. Then there were some from the wedding ceremony…the wedding that wasn’t even meant for her…Jai had only put up pictures which had Bani in them…looking radiant and happy, preparing for her sister Pia’s marriage…then there was one picture of hers with Jai…the one that had been taken during the Press meet that Jai had called after their sudden marriage. Her entire life in the past one year came cascading infront of her, as she moved from one picture to another…each one of them drawing out Jai and her story in phases…the look of gloom and fear in some of the earlier pictures replaced by a shy and confused smile in others…and then the pictures where Bani had spotted a radiant glow that only love could give you…she stood staring at them, completely mesmerized and astounded that Jai had collected all those memories with so much care and never once expressed anything to her.
She was shaken out of her reverie when she heard the door click open and as she turned to face it, Jai came in, slumped, unshaven and intoxicated…but his entire persona underwent a drastic shock, when he saw her standing in the middle of his apartment room.
‘Bani?’ his voice came out like a lost whisper, like a dream he was seeing with open eyes.

Part 2 A
Just as it had always been, words became futile, when Jai and Bani came face to face once again, after a long time…and a time which had been the most emotionally and physically demanding on them. Jai tried to focus his bleary eyes, not sure if she was actually present or he was hallucinating.
Bani stood frozen staring at her husband, shocked by the change that had come over him. He looked so broken and so helpless, that her heart cried out in anguish and despair. Why had she let go of her marriage so easily? Why had she let an incident of the past cloud her emotions and feelings for Jai? Why had she assumed that Jai had never loved her and could possibly never love her? Why hadn’t she listened to her heart even once?
Too many memories were coming back, good and bad, too many old emotions stirred deeply within her. She had walked out on her marriage but she had never stopped loving her husband for even a single moment. And she knew now that she never would. But learn to live with it? Every moment that she saw him only made that seem more impossible.
Jai took a few steps forward, missing the steps that led to the living area from the front door and stumbled forward, losing his balance. In a reflex action, Bani lurched forward to support him and he came to fall on her, instantly holding her in his arms to avoid making her fall with his body weight.
Bani found her moist eyes closing in the warmth and security of his embrace…resting her head on his chest, she wept softly, not able to meet his eyes any longer and not wanting this moment to ever end.
‘Please tell me this is not a dream, Bani…’ his voice came out slightly unsteady and his face looked staggered, not believing that his wife was actually in his arms.
Bani lifted her head and gazed up at his face…he seemed to have aged a few years, the bright intensity in his eyes looked dim and the energy from his body seemed to have been sapped out. Caressing his unshaven jaw line with her soft palms, she spoke haltingly, ‘And if it is a dream, then I don’t want it to break…’
Jai drew her slowly further close to him, his eyes holding hers. She was already trembling with anticipation even before he lowered his head to find her lips, touching them gently, with exquisite tenderness, like a mortal allowed to sip the nectar of the gods.
His fingers gripped her waist so tightly that they bruised her skin, but she didn’t feeli it; her hands were on his head, in his hair, holding his mouth against her own, drowning in his kisses. But then Jai broke away, holding her by the length of his arms, his hands gripping her shoulders. His breath was uneven, panting, his mouth parted, and she could feel the beating of his heart. But it was his eyes that held her. They were so full of triumphant happiness, like a man who had found his long-sought for grail and claimed it for his own. Suddenly he dropped his hands to her waist and lifted her high off the ground, they swung her around in giddy circles. ‘I love you!’ he shouted. ‘I love you, Bani.’
And the vast expanse of the room that surrounded them took up his cry, echoing one off another, until the air was full of its mad peal. And Bani’s ears filled with his avowal, ‘I love you. I love you, Bani.’
She cried a little then, from happiness, and he kissed her tears away. ‘I don’t deserve this.’
But Jai looked at her and said intently. ‘You deserve everything you’re going to get, Bani…everything!’
A remark that made her blush crimson and yet light her eyes with unfathomable happiness.
Coming closer to her, Jai lifted a tendril off her cheeks and looking lovingly into her face whispered softly, ‘Light attaches to you in whichever corner of the world you might be Bani…’
They spent the rest of the night in each other’s arms, comforting and supportive…talking about what had happened…Jai kissed away all of Bani’s tears when she broke down crying helplessly, while recounting how she had survived the brutal attack that had led to her miscarriage. Jai held her close to his chest, comforting her through the emotional breakdown, not telling her anything about the fact that he had hunted down the attackers and given them a chilling retribution for laying hand on his wife and child. Jai did not want to rake up the talk of past anymore…all that he cared for was that the woman he loved was alive and was with him…everything else blurred in front of his new found happiness.
It was close to midnight when Bani woke up with a start. She had fallen asleep with her head on Jai’s chest, both of them slumped against the huge couch in the living room.
‘What happened?’ he asked her with the kind of softness in his eyes and voice that she hadn’t seen for ages. Looking slightly disoriented, she lifted her head and looked around the room, blinking her eyes, still a bit unbelieving that she was actually with her husband…so up close with him and that he had just told her that he loved her…the fact that happiness could come back to her life once again astounded Bani into a state of motionlessness.
‘Bani…are you okay?’ Jai place his finger under her chin, lifting her puzzled looking face…which was still the most beautiful face in the whole world, despite the unhealed bruises on them…since love was giving her whole self a surreal, divine glow.
‘I…Massi must be wondering what is taking me so long…and Tony…he would be waiting downstairs.’ Looking at him for some kind of support, she asked in a puzzled child like manner, ‘Should I go back there?’
An amused expression flirted on Jai’s face and hiding his grin he asked with seriousness, ‘Go where?’
‘Home…’ she spoke hesitatingly, not sure if Walia House was her home…since her husband was living somewhere else.
Jai could himself back no longer and burst out laughing wildly, taking Bani aback…when he had controlled his laughter, he looked into her flushed face and spoke lovingly, ‘You are so shy…that you can’t even tell your own husband that you want to stay here with me…and instead you are asking me where you should go now?’
Feeling extremely shy and awkward at Jai’s teasing, Bani felt herself fumbling with her words, remembering the passionate and long drawn kiss they had just shared…even though they had been married for almost 6 months before they had got separated, there was never any physical intimacy between them…except for that one night…the memories of which still made Bani aglow from head to toe. And now she felt extremely shy and bashful in his presence, all the sudden, feeling like a newly married.
Not able to take Jai’s intense look and the passion in his eyes, she quickly hid her face in his chest once again, so that she wouldn’t have to face him anymore.
There was no reaction from him for sometime and Bani wondered if she could lift her hot, flushed face and just run away to Walia Mansion, more out of the extreme awkwardness of the situation than any desire to go away from Jai.
He interrupted her thoughts by a simple line that stunned her completely.
‘Will you start a new journey with me once again, Bani?’
She looked up at him, there was no teasing, no flirting and no amusement in his eyes…instead was such sincerity and such love that she felt physically touched by his emotions for her.
She kept staring at him, till he smiled faintly and said, ‘Our past is behind us…and even though I can’t promise to keep you happy for the rest of our lives…I can promise upon my life that I will never become the reason of your sorrow and pain again…and even if I have to move mountains, I will never let anyone or anything ever bring tears in those eyes.’
Bani had stood up by now and Jai came close to her, gazing at her face for some time, till he surprised her by dropping onto his knees and taking a white lily from a nearby vase, looked up at her and said simply, ‘Will you marry me Bani?’
Tears streaming down her pale cheeks, which were flushed beyond comprehension, she bent down to reach his level and taking the flower from his hand, hugged him tightly and said, in between incessant crying, ‘A thousand times over…’
Part 2 B
‘Unbelievable…’ announced a dramatically stunned looking Tarun.
Jai gave a smug look and tried to hide his grin, feeling a bit embarrassed at the attention he had unwittingly ended up getting after he had broken the news to Aditya and Tarun in the Office.
‘So you get to marry the same woman twice over…and I am still a bachelor…’
Aditya who looked astounded himself, joined in, ‘Tarun you are still better off…look at me…my brother-in-law is getting married for the second time over…and I am still a divorcee...’
Jai colored slightly and giving them both a stern look said, ‘Will you both stop clowning around and get back to work? I need to set up a meeting with McWilliams asap. Lets call Ranveer and Nachiket to get a feedback on their last meeting with him.’
Tarun shrugged his head and said, ‘To hell with McWilliams…first tell us all about the proposal…did you go down on your knees…did you give her a ring…’
Aditya chimed in enthusiastically, ‘Did you play some music? Did you sing a song for her? Was she taken aback?’
Jai gave both his best friends a look and said as seriously as he could manage, ‘Well, firstly, it’s none of your bloody business…and secondly, we are on the verge of losing one of our most important clients…boys, get back to work! Please!’
Tarun and Aditya both burst out laughing, noticing the tinge of red that had conspicuously appeared on both sides of his tanned cheeks.
‘You are blushing…’ screamed Tarun, laughing uncontrollably, only to be joined in by Aditya who said, ‘Where the hell is my Camera…this is a Kodak moment…Tarun, we can give a picture of Jai blushing like a teenager to Bani as her wedding gift…’
Jai couldn’t hold back his laughter anymore and rubbing an agitated hand through his hair, remarked to both of them, ‘Get lost you both…and stop pulling my leg. Your voice will be heard all over the office…’
Just then Nachiket and Ranveer came in and even though both of them held Jai in far too much respect and awe to joke alongside him, even they couldn’t control themselves over the ribbing that Jai was getting from both his best friends.
‘Did you hear Nachiket? Your brother is getting back your Bhabhi home…and shame on you for not even finding a girlfriend for yourself till now!’
Nachiket grinned widely at Aditya’s joke and addressing Jai, spoke affectionately, ‘Congratulations Bhaiyya…I can’t tell you how happy I am…for both you and Bhabhi.’
Ranveer added with a quiet smile, ‘Congratulations Mamaji…’
Jai felt suddenly conscious of himself and trying not to fluster himself anymore and become the target of Aditya and Tarun’s teasing, he ushered everyone to get back to work…now that he had Bani back in his life, Jai’s focus had reverted back with all seriousness to his work, that he had been neglecting severely for the last few months.
Walia Mansion
‘Di, what did you both talk about? Did he tell you how much he had missed you? Did he hug you? Did you both kiss? Did you both…’
Bani blushed crimson and kept a finger on Rano’s lips and spoke in a low voice, ‘Ssssh…someone will hear you Rano…’
Rano laughed and said, ‘So what are you thinking then? That you two will get married again and no one here would come to know? Massi is already making preparations…and Raashi and I are so excited…all the trousseau shopping, dancing, singing, laughing, teasing…’
Looking at the expression on Bani’s face, she took her sister’s face in her hands and said lovingly, ‘You are going to live your dream for the second time over…and this time…there will only be happiness and love in your marriage…no ghosts of the past will come between you and Mr. Walia.’
Bani paused for sometime before speaking in her soft tone, ‘Where is Pia?’
Rano looked disgruntled at the mention of their sister’s name and said, ‘Why do you keep getting her in between? And now especially, when everything is falling into place once again…and please don’t forget how awkward Mr. Walia is going to feel if she is around when you two get married.’
‘She is our sister Rano…after Ma’s death, I took care of both of you like my own children…how can I ever leave her out of my life?’
Rano shrugged her head despondently and remarked back, ‘I know all that…but things have changed Di…and I know that you will never to anything that might cause hurt to the person whom you love the most…and seeing Pia at this time is not going to make Mr. Walia happy.’
Bani was silenced for sometime till Raashi came chiming in, ‘Mamiji…the wedding date has been fixed on the 22nd of this month…that’s just a fortnight later…’
Both Bani and Rano looked stunned at Raashi who stared back at them and said, ‘What happened?’ And then added teasingly, ‘Is it too long to wait for you?’
Bani spoke in a slow manner, ‘No…its…it’s the date of our wedding anniversary also…’
Raashi was taken aback and spoke in a knowing manner, ‘So that is why Jai Mamaji chose this date of the entire one’s that Massi had suggested?’
Rano and Raashi had no end of teasing Bani for the rest of the evening, refusing to let even call up Jai, saying that no one will allow them to meet or even talk till the wedding ceremony happens.
Part 2 C
Jai’s Apartment
‘This is ridiculous…why can’t I meet my own wife?’ Jai sounded severely annoyed as he banged the phone down, which he had made to Walia Mansion to speak with Bani, but was met with a strict warning by Massi that till the wedding takes place, he should not come to Walia House and definitely not try and meet up with Bani.
‘Well technically buddy…she is no longer your wife…because you both ended up signing the divorce papers which are lying in my office…and till you get married again, you cannot officially call her your wife.’
Jai turned to give a very cross look at Tarun who was munching on to an Apple with delight, reveling in his friend’s desperate situation.
‘Who the hell asked for your comments?’
‘How rude and how ungrateful! If not for me, you would have become a full blown Jaidas by now…singing songs in your Bani’s memories…and its really sad because you have an awful singing voice.’
Jai took a cushion and aimed it sharply at Tarun’s head, who had fallen off the couch, laughing wildly.
‘You did nothing great…I would have anyway gone to her and sorted out everything…’
Tarun raised his eyebrows and said, ‘Yeah sure…for someone who took ages coming to terms with the fact that you were in love…sure you would have gone and sorted things out…Jai, you might be the brightest entrepreneurial mind we have amongst us, but when it comes to the matter of heart, you are sadly miles behind…’
‘Will you shut up or should I throw you out of the window?’
Tarun grinned in response and said, ‘and if you land in jail, your poor bride will be kept waiting at the aisle…now you wouldn’t want to do something like that to Bani, right?’
Jai laughed out in frustration and said, ‘It’s my mistake that I set to argue with a lawyer…so okay, you win…’
Tarun refused to give in and said, ‘And you agree that it’s only because of me that Bani is back in your life?’
Jai spoke in a passionate voice, ‘No. She is back in my life, because she always belonged there…and will always be there.’
Tarun raised his hands in reconciliation and said, ‘You win the final round, Mr. Walia and get to keep your queen also!’
Later At Night
Bani who was still taking medicines slept soundly at night because of the sedatives and it took several rings for her to pick up the phone near her bedside.
‘Tell me that you were dreaming of me and that is why your sleep took so long to break?’ Jai was leaning back on the couch and smiling as he had called up Bani at night, assured that everyone would be fast asleep at Walia Mansion.
‘Huh…’ Bani’s voice sounded groggy as she tried to orient herself and recognizing Jai’s voice, felt her cheeks go a bit hot.
‘Aap…this time at night? Is everything fine?’
‘No…it’s not actually…’
Bani panicked and getting up on the bed said, ‘What happened? Are you feeling ill? Did you ring the doctor? Did you take your medicines after dinner?’
Jai answered back in a languorous tone, ‘It’s to do with my heart…Bani…’
Bani’s voice was now completely panic stricken and she said, ‘Your heart? What happened? Is it paining? Are you having palpitations? Is your heartbeat increased?’
Laughing at her concern and franticness over him, he replied back in flirtatious tone, ‘All that and much more! But not because of any medical reasons…It has to do with the fact that I have fallen in love for the first time so late in life…hence I think my heart is working a bit overtime to keep up with all those feelings that I have for you.’
Bani blushed to the root of her hair and found herself going speechless. She had always known her husband to be the quietest man she had ever known…a man of very few words…and to hear him express his feelings in such a blatant manner completely rattled Bani.
Trying to recover the overwhelming sense of shyness she felt, Bani spoke bashfully, ‘Did you call me at this time to say all this?’
‘Since we are getting married for the second time, I wanted it to be a love marriage…and I was just doing the courtship bit…’
Bani started laughing and said, ‘I can’t believe that you could speak like this…’
‘You will be subjected to a lot of surprises this time round, Bani…’
Bani felt herself going hot and cold on the manner that Jai had just said those words and fumbling with the instrument she said hurriedly, ‘I have to keep the phone…Rano is sleeping with me…she might wake up…’
‘Keep counting every moment till we meet again for the next 7 life’s…’
Bani felt her eyes going moist and after a moment’s hesitation, spoke with extreme diffidence, ‘Suniye...’
Jai answered back in the same tone, ‘Kahiye…’
They both started laughing till Bani said almost inaudibly, ‘I love you, Mr. Walia…’
‘You sound like you are wishing me to get well soon, Bani…we are not in my office and you are not my employee any longer…’
Bani tried to suppress her blushing and giggling, not wanting to wake up Rano and get teased by her also.
Jai braced up in a matter of fact tone and said, ‘Next when we both are alone…and that I think will only be during our wedding night…I want you to call me by my name…’
Bani gasped a bit and said, ‘I can’t…’
Jai answered back with a hint of wickedness in his voice, ‘Then I won’t let you out of our room till you call me Jai…you better face everyone alone when asks you why you were up so long in the morning.’
Bani’s cheeks were a flaming red now and all she could say on the phone before collapsing on her pillow with happiness was, ‘Good night…and take your medicines on time…and don’t drink please…and call me up tomorrow also…and…’
Jai laughed and cutting in short said, ‘And yes, I love you lots too!’

Part 3 A
Jai felt his head splitting up with so many people talking at the same time and he wisely decided to keep quiet till the commotion had died down.
He had come over to Walia Mansion to collect some documents from his study that he had back here, and had hoped for a meeting with Bani too, which looked impossible as of now.
‘Jai, tum batao? I think we should have a party at the Taj...it has a grand ballroom and can accommodate almost a thousand people.’ Aditya ventured enthusiastically.
Nachiket negated the idea and said, ‘I think we should have the party at one of our Hotels…the Orchard Ballroom is a great venue…’
Ranveer said quietly, ‘Or maybe our property in Khandala…we can ferry all the guests from Mumbai till there…’
Massi turned to look her nephew who was sitting expressionless, not saying a single word. ‘Arre...the groom is not saying a word and he is the one who is getting married. Munna, you tell me, where do you want the function to be held?’
Jai gave an amused look at everyone but spoke with all seriousness, ‘Firstly, it’s our marriage ceremony and not a function and secondly, I am not going in for any carnival of celebration. It will be a simple ceremony held here at Walia Mansion with only family and close friends. End of topic.’
The emphatic-ness with which Jai had pronounced these words left everyone speechless and they finally ended up liking the idea of a close-knit family function much better than organizing a grand event.
Jai turned to look at Massi and asked casually, ‘Where is Bani?’
Rano who had been sitting nearby grinned mischievously at Raashi and both of them started giggling, embarrassing Jai. Irritated he said, ‘I just want to go and ask how she is feeling…what is so funny about it?’
Rano immediately got a serious expression and muttered about Bani being in the Terrace.
Jai leaned on the wrought iron swing without making it move, so that he could see what Bani was sketching with such concentration. It was a half-formed drawing of a woman holding a child in her arms and the figure of a man holding them both in his arms.
Jai did not know whether to smile or cry at what he saw…happy for the fact that in spite of all that happened, Bani still saw happiness for the future or sad for the fact that he could do nothing to prevent what had happened.
He noticed that she kept pushing the strands of hair from her cheeks when they came in her view and lifting them by his fingers, he gently tucked them behind her ears. Startled at the intrusion, she swung backwards to see Jai standing and looked shocked.
‘Its okay…its just me.’ He said soothingly when he saw the expression on her face, noticing sadly that the shock of the attack still lingered in her psyche.
‘Aap…’ she ventured timidly, feeling extremely shy.
‘Yes its me…not my evil twin brother and now stop looking so bashful. When you get so awkward, even I feel the same.’
Blushingly Bani turned her face the other side, till Jai came and sat near her in the swing. ‘Do you remember that day when I had shouted on you for coming to my Office with the lunch? I had felt so guilty by evening and when I came home, you were nowhere to be seen…I obviously couldn’t ask anyone about you…so I had gone about searching the whole place, till Tony finally told me that you are in the Terrace…’
Bani looked at him, smiling, as he recounted the earlier days of their marriage, feeling both strange yet comforted by the fact that Jai was talking with so much ease and casualness with her, when earlier, even looking at each other’s faces seemed to be a huge effort.
Jai continued, putting his arm around her waist and drawing her closer to him, ‘I finally came to the Terrace to see you sitting on the parapet wall…and even though my conscience told me to go and apologize to you, my ego was too big for that…so I kept looking at you from a distance…’
Bani finally managed to utter a word, more out of surprise on what she had just heard, ‘You wanted to apologize to me?’
Jai looked amused at the wonder in her voice and said, ‘Why? Did you think I was such a monster that I couldn’t even say sorry when I had been rude to you?’
Bani blushed and lowered her face to avoid replying and Jai began laughing at her gesture, saying, ‘So I was a monster, right?’
‘No…of course not.’ She responded, trying to sound vehement, but not really succeeding.
Jai kept gazing at her when she flushed pink and tried to avoid looking back at him and all in a moment wondered what on earth had he been thinking of during the six months of their marriage. How come he hadn’t noticed the curve of her mouth as she bits her lips to avoid her embarrassment, the way her eyes sparkled when she smiled, how her voice chimed like silver bells when she laughed, the softness of her skin, the darkness of her hair. Jai felt truly surprised at the fact that he had never felt a physical attraction towards Bani ever before…of course he had not remain untouched by the goodness of her heart, by her gentle nature and kind gestures, by her caring and loving attitude towards everyone, by the fact that she never lost her temper even if provoked to the very extreme, the fact that she never held grudges even though Jai and his family had been nothing but unfair towards her.
But the fact that he had never looked at Bani as a man looks at a woman seemed to stagger him awfully. Feeling awkward by the manner in which Jai was staring at her, she begun talking vaguely about the first thing that came to her mind, but only till he clasped his arms tightly around her waist and pulled her towards him in one sweep.
Kissing her gently yet firmly on her lips, he let her go only when she began gasping for breath. Stunned she stared at him, till he spoke with a mad passion in his eyes, ‘I have been blind all this while and now that I can see what I had missing…the wait is going to make me go crazy.’
She looked up at him, shy and diffident yet the happiness of hearing such words from Jai couldn’t stop the happiness reflecting from her eyes. Not hearing anything from Bani, he took her by her shoulders and said in a beguiled tone, ‘Why are you so tongue-tied with me around, Bani? Earlier, I could understand that you were afraid of me…but now?’
Bani found herself shrinking further and placed her head on his shoulders, refusing to look up. Jai held her in his arms and spoke provokingly, ‘Are you planning to hide yourself from me for the rest of our lives? If so, then I think I will have to make some alternate arrangements…’
On hearing this, she immediately looked up, a bit hurt and taken aback. He smiled and spoke teasingly, ‘and by alternate arrangements, I meant loving you so much, so much, that you would never be able to escape me…so you still have time to make your decision!’
Bani laughed and finally spoke, ‘I can’t believe you are the same person…’
‘Who tortured you…hurt you…made you cry…’
With a look of intense softness in her eyes, she whispered, ‘No the same person who trusted me despite everything that happened…who gave a chance to me and our marriage…the same person who made me realize what love is all about.’
Jai found himself going speechless and they just kept looking into each other’s eyes, till the sound of someone approaching the terrace disturbed their trance.
‘Hello there…I thought you two weren’t supposed to meet till D-day?’ Tarun announced cheerfully.
Jai gave a deadpan look at his best friend and said, ‘Why do you keep following me everywhere, Tarun? In the office, at my apartment and now here? Don’t you have work to do?’
Tarun laughed alongside Bani who felt extremely awkward and before Tarun could begin ribbing them both, walked out of the terrace, refusing to listen to both Tarun and Jai trying to stop her.
Tarun came and sat on the swing along with Jai and picked up the half finished sketch that Bani had been drawing. Suddenly serious after seeing what she had drawn, he looked at Jai and said, ‘She is still to come out of that shock, isn’t it?’
Jai noiselessly nodded his head to the statement and later added, ‘I wish I had seen some sense before on…all that happened could have been avoided…’
‘Things could have been worse…and besides what you went through was natural…’
Jai smiled cryptically and remarked back, ‘Taking all the anger and ire I had for Pia and Pushkar on Bani was natural? Maybe…but it was also very unfair…and I can’t tell you how miserable I feel thinking about it.’
Tarun kept quiet, looking at Jai’s serious face till he spoke with a quiet determination, ‘But I am going to make it up to her…whatever it takes to give her happiness, I will do it.’
Tarun smiled looking at his friend and said, ‘I am thrilled that the love bug hasn’t bitten me till date…looking at your condition over Bani…its scares the living daylight out of me…first you were in this pathetic and painful condition when she was in the hospital and now that you are love-struck and starry-eyed.’
Jai went a bit crimson and getting a blustery look said, ‘Obviously you refuse to grow up and that is why you are still single…so don’t envy my luck.’
Tarun laughed alongside his friend and said ruefully, ‘I was rather hoping to have some luck with Bani when she had filed for divorce against you…’
Jai gave a stumped look at his best friend and abused him cheerfully, ‘You s***e!’
‘Hey…mind your language, else I will tell you wife about it! She seems to have too good an impression about her Mr. Walia…I think I should place a call to all your ex-girlfriends from school, university and Management College…let them all be a part of this wedding. And then we will see how you deal with your newly wed wife when she meets up with the throngs of your ex-flames and gets to know about your colorful past!’
Both of them laughed unrestrainedly on that and Jai fearing that the loud-mouthed Tarun might end up saying something on these lines to Bani and upset her, made him swear that he wouldn’t say anything to Bani regarding his college days.
Part 3 B
The entire Walia Family contingent had gathered for the wedding and everyone was in high spirits and extremely joyful for the two people who everyone loved and adored, Jai and Bani. Even Jigyasa who still held some prejudices against her brother’s wife could not help but join in the celebrations. She badly wanted to make it up with Jai and knew that the only manner in which she could thaw Jai’s coldness towards her was through Bani.
Jai continued calling up Bani every night, but not used to talk so much, they were invariably silent on the phone, yet understanding those unspoken words too.
After finishing his work one evening, Jai had planned to go to a nearby Pub along with Tarun and Aditya for drinks, since both of them teased him that he was about to lose his bachelor status again and he better make the best of his shortly available freedom. His other best friend, Mohan Khandelwal and Gaurav Gupta had also come to Mumbai to join in the wedding and they were also joining him at the Pub.
He had sent away his driver and was walking towards his Car standing in the front porch of his Office building that he saw a familiar figure standing in the distance. The sudden surprise of seeing Pia made Jai stare at her astounded for some time, till she came walking towards him.
Even in the setting dimness of the twilight hour, she looked beautiful. The same stunning good looks and charm that had bowled his heart away the very first time he had seen her along with Bani and Rano at his house.
Giving him a timid smile, she ventured gingerly, ‘Hello, Mr. Walia.’
Jai’s stupor broke and he answered back poker-faced, ‘Hi, Pia.’
‘Um…are you going home?’
He answered back just as formally, ‘No.’
Getting a snub response from him, she floundered a bit on her words but managed to say, ‘I…I wanted to speak with you…I couldn’t come to Walia Mansion…your secretary wouldn’t give me an appointment till I told her the reason…so…’
‘Get to the point, Pia. I have some friends waiting for me.’
Noticing her nervousness and the fact that some of his employees were staring at both of them, Jai tackled the situation and said briskly, ‘Get into the Car…let’s speak on our way. I will drop you…wherever you are living.’
Pia felt distinctly uncomfortable sitting alongside Jai in the closed interior of the Car…the closeness to him sent unimaginable shivers through her whole body. And trapped between the feeling of the intense attraction that she felt towards him and of the guilt that overcame her, whenever she thought about what she had done, she felt herself going nauseated.
Looking at her white pallor, Jai said with minimal concern in his voice, ‘Are you alright? Should I stop the Car?’
Flustered she muttered, ‘Yes, Mr. Walia…could you please stop the Car.’
Thinking that she was about to be sick, Jai immediately took the Car to a corner and stopped it, getting out and opening her side of the door. Pia didn’t throw up but just seemed to exhilarate in the open air, as if someone had let her free from a closed box after a long time.
Turning to face him, she said with desperation written all over face, ‘Mr. Walia…please forgive me.’
Dazed at the sudden statement from her, it took a while for Jai to recover, but when he did, all he said in an unforgiving voice was, ‘Too little…Too late.’
Pia was rendered speechless by the finality in his voice, but did not give up and in-between tearing up begged, ‘But why Mr. Walia…you said that you loved me…you wanted to marry me…you were so heartbroken when I left you…then how can you be so hard-hearted for me.’
Not getting a single response on her emotional outburst, she wept some more and said, ‘Your marriage is also over…and I have filed for a divorce from Pushkar…then…then why can’t things be the same as it was before all this happened?’
Jai kept his hand on his Car and looking at her, spoke after a few moments of silence, ‘You seem to have your memory blanked out, Pia…in-between my falling in love with you and your questioning my feelings now, my entire life underwent a change!’
Looking at the expression of confusion on Pia’s face, Jai added simply, ‘Bani and I are back together…we are getting married next week.’
Shocked at the news, it took a while for Pia to gather her guts, but then with a show of adamancy that was second nature to her, she said, ‘You are going to live the rest of your life with a woman out of guilt rather than love? And force my sister to live a loveless life too?’
Jai was uncommunicative and taking that as an expression of the fact that she was getting across her point, Pia walked towards him and spoke, almost hysterical, ‘I know that Di is still in a shock after losing the baby…that she risked her life to protect you…and that you feel obliged to be with her now…but Bani di doesn’t love you, Mr. Walia…she did not even want to marry you…your marriage was forced upon her…and upon you…even that child was a mistake…why do you want to repeat the same mistake again?’
Jai kept staring at Pia and then suddenly broke out laughing raucously. So wild and feral was his laughter, that Pia felt daunted and scared, till he calmed down and still gulping in between the bitter laugh spoke in an amused tone, ‘Now I know the reason why it took me so long to realize that Bani was the one whom God had chosen for me…that we got married because it was our destiny to be together…’
Now it was Pia’s turned to be stunned into silence, while Jai spoke ruthlessly, ‘Pia, it was your beauty that had blinded me into thinking that I was in love with you…that I wanted to live my life with the woman who was so perfect…so beautiful…so full of life. And when you walked out on me, without any fault of mine, all my illusions about love, about human goodness and trust in relationships was shattered…you ended up eroding all that I had held valuable in life and made me into this empty shell, that had nothing to give but anger and hatred.’
Breaking the silence of the night, Jai spoke quietly, ‘I admit that you were the one to make me realize what love was…but it was Bani who taught me the value of that love…when you shook my faith, it was Bani who reinstated it…when you broke my heart, it was she who helped heal it…when you gave me humiliation, pain and tears, it was she who took all that away and made me trust life again.’
‘We have both lived each other’s pain and heartbreak, Pia…and seen the worst of one another, yet chose to stay loyal and committed…and if that is not love, then I guess, I don’t want to be ever in love…I chose the nameless emotion I share with Bani over everything else in the world.’
He spoke quietly, ‘Take my Car and drive back home…and I still hope and wish that Bani and my relationship never comes in the way of you both sisters.’
Saying that, Jai walked off in the darkness and the last sound Pia heard was the sound of the Cab driving away, leaving behind a swirl of dust.
Pia had never been kicked in the teeth before but now she knew exactly how it felt. She recoiled, every emotion appalled by what she hear. And perhaps for the first time, since she had walked out of Jai Walia’s life, she felt her heart surge with an overwhelming feeling of self-pity and guilt and bitterness at her own stupidity, at her selfishness and the folly of youth, which had made her leave him but had confidently expected him to do what she wanted and come after her.
A great anguish filled Pia’s heart, lacerated it, a despair so deep that she was beyond tears. She had asked Jai why he wouldn’t take her back in his life and now he had told her. She had lost him, perhaps from the very moment she had walked out and Bani had walked in his life. Any love he had for her was as dead as the dust on ground, buried too deep for him to do anything but despise her.
So it was over – for Jai. But Pia knew now that for her the real hurting had only just began.
Part 3 C
When Jai entered Walia Mansion, he felt almost nauseated by the smell of jasmine flowers mingled with sweets and incense sticks and many other smells, that hit one’s sense during an Indian wedding ceremony. The banisters and staircase were decorated in golden marigold and there was a huge centre-piece made of Roses and Lilies, Jai and Bani’s favorite flowers.
Rano who was rattling out some instructions to Tony noticed Jai standing quietly near the door, a witness to the frenzy of activity going on for the wedding that was to take place in two days time.
She came smiling down to meet him and before he could get in a word, said, ‘You can’t meet Di…and if your force your way up, I will have to tell Massi and then the only way you can get married is by eloping with my sister.’
Jai and Rano both started laughing and he said, ‘I came to give something to Bani…where is she?’
‘She is upstairs in the terrace with the others…getting Mehendi on her hands.’ Rano continued emotionally, ‘Even though you two are getting married for the second time…everything feels so new…so unique. The last time I saw Bani di this happy was after Saahil and Raashi’s sangeet ceremony…’
Jai smiled at her and said, ‘Yes…everything does feel like new…and even though I am an atheist, I will place a request to every God for giving me the strength and ability to fill Bani’s life with happiness and love.’
Rano felt herself tearing up and said, ‘Now you are getting me so emotional…and the ceremony hasn’t even started…I am going to bawl my heart out then.’
Jai laughed and said, ‘I promise not to land up again till the wedding time, but please could you get her to meet me just once…I am in my room..’ and then added with an afterthought, ‘I mean, our room…’
Rano blushed and giggled, running off to the terrace to try and wrangle Bani out of the group of relatives who had gathered her.
Jai was coming to his bedroom after what he felt was ages…the room was spic and span as usual…but the fact that it had been unlived for the past few months could be clearly seen. A wave of strong emotions hit Jai when he looked at his room…the place which had been his private chamber ever since he had turned 5 years old and his parent’s had specially made the room for him. Though hating to sleep all alone at that age, Jai had grown accustomed to have the place all for his own over the years. So much so that, even his parent’s had to knock and enter the room when he had reached his teen years and later he wouldn’t allow anyone inside the room, except when it required cleaning.
And then suddenly, one fine night he had stumbled drunk into his room, only to be shocked by the presence of his newly wed wife, Bani, looking terrified and lost. He had screamed on Jigyasa the next day for letting that ‘girl’ inside his bedroom, but had let her stay on because he realized that it was the only way to stop any gossip taking place in the servants quarters on the issue of Mrs. and Mr. Walia sharing separate rooms.
Bani had been almost unobtrusive…and he had never seen her except as a piece of furniture that had been added to the room. But small things she did began to come to his notice…the way she always took out his night clothes and kept them pressed and ready to wear on his side of the bed. Or his morning tea that was brought to him at sharp 7, just as he was getting up from his sleep. And sometimes when he woke up in the morning, he would notice his shoes kept neatly below the bed and his jacket and tie folded neatly and kept on the chair…which used to remind him how drunk he had been the night before and in spite of his condition, Bani had helped him get to bed.
A smile came over his lips, when he touched the soft sheet…the first morning when he had found Bani sleeping with her head on his arms…he had been so taken aback that at first he wanted to shrug her off roughly, but when he saw her face…innocent, guiless and at such peace with herself, he had let her catch a few winks…even though his arm had felt just as discomfited as his growing feelings for her.
Jai laughed lightly remembering the night when he had come very late, from Roshni’s house and found Bani to be sleeping…and so used was he to her presence, that one look at her and he could guess that she had been awoke till a minute back and was only pretending sleep so that he wouldn’t come to know that she had waited for him this long. In spite of the rancor he held in his heart against Bani at that time, her caring and concern for him had touched his heart…the fact that after his Mother’s death, Bani was the only person who would stay awake this late to see that he had come back home hale and hearty was something that overwhelmed Jai badly. He had found it very difficult to be his usual rude self to her from then onwards.
As the muslin curtains danced away in the evening breeze coming from the Ocean which enjoyed a beautiful view from Jai’s bedroom, the most cherished night of his life evoked every bit of his memory.
9 Months Back
The night of Saahil / Raashi and Anu / Rohit's Sangeet Ceremony
Jai entered the room, his head slightly spinning with the overdose of champagne that Roshni had forced down his throat. The very thought of Roshni, filled Jai’s senses with a nausea of disgust and hatred…..what sort of women was he surrounded by, wondered Jai…and just then, he saw Bani standing in front of the large bay window. Jai was surprised, he definitely wasn’t expecting Bani here….he had searched for her in the Party, but apparently she was nowhere around and he assumed that she must have been in one of the rooms with Rano or Massi. Jai stood rooted to his place and kept staring at the solitary figure in front of him….how ethereal and beautiful she looked, with the pale, silvery moonlight casting a gentle shadow in the room....How fragile, delicate and vulnerable was Bani….so untouched and so pristine…..Jai suddenly jolted out of his thoughts as Bani turned her head to look at him, her tear-strained face registering surprise and then a deep anguish and pain. Jai and Bani kept looking at one another for some time and suddenly the darkened room seemed to illuminate with some unknown force.
“What happened Bani? Why are you crying?”
Jai’s voice expressed a deep concern yet a soothing gentleness as he walked towards Bani, who clenched her fists tightly and turned her face from Jai, but could not stop her tears from flowing. “Bani? Bani? What happened? Look at me. Bani, I am speaking to you.”
Jai was speaking with great alarm and disquiet now as he held Bani gently by her shoulders and turned her towards him, as Bani kept her head bowed down and silently wept. As Bani kept quite, Jai lifted her face by her chin very softly and saw that she was now weeping openly, almost like a child. Jai took Bani’s face in the palms of his hand and asked her again, with the same gentle authority, “What happened Bani? Are you feeling unwell? Or did someone say anything to you? Why did you leave the party all of a sudden?”
Bani looked at Jai in his eyes and the warm protectiveness and strength in them made Bani lose any sense of control that she possessed till now and she broke down completely as she said between sobs, “I want to go back. I want to go away from you. I want to go away from your life.”
Jai was so stunned by what Bani said that he let go of her and with a confused shock kept looking at her for some time, as she racked with sobs. “What are you talking about Bani? Where do you want to go? What happened? For god sake, stop crying and tell me something.”
Bani kept sobbing as she tried to wipe her face dry but a fresh bout of tears besieged her again and in between sobs she said again, “I want to go back to Mount Abu. I don’t want to live in this house.”
Jai was now really stunned and couldn’t in the World fathom what had gone wrong with Bani all of a sudden, he remembered slightly that she looked unwell throughout the party and also a little lost than usual….but what had so happened that made her react in such a manner. As Jai asked Bani in the same gentle but firm tone again, “Alright. If you want to leave, I won’t stop you. But atleast, tell me what happened.”
Jai once again lifted Bani’s tearful face towards him as she looked at Jai and the vortex of emotions that had so tortured her for the past few weeks came tumbling down like a cascading waterfall as she replied back, “You like Roshni, isn’t it? Then I won’t come in between your happiness. I don’t want to become the reason of your grief once again. I will go away.”
As Bani released herself from Jai and started walking ahead, wobbling almost, because of the throbbing headache she had, Jai froze in his spot as he simply could not believe what he had just heard and for sometime Jai just kept staring at nothingness as Bani’s words rang through his mind.
“Stop, Bani.” Jai’s voice was steady and in control now as he held Bani by her arms and holding them with a firm tenderness he stopped Bani and came in front of her and as Bani looked up to Jai, even in her disturbed state, she could see that the man standing in front of her was someone different…someone she had not know previously in person, but only in imagination. Jai’s eyes held something else today and before Bani could say or react further, Jai gathered Bani close to him and holding her gently by her waist, planted a passionate yet warm kiss on her forehead. As a stunned, teary eyed Bani kept staring at Jai, her mind in a turmoil and her body as if in a limbo, Jai’s eyes seemed to hold a love so deep that it seemed to tear the solitary darkness of their room and radiated every inch of Bani’s self. Bani staggered for a while, the drink she had consumed was fogging her head but somehow she knew what had just happened to her was not her dream….no this was for real….the warmth, the caress, the gentle touch on her forehead….it could not be her dream, yet why did everything feel so ethereal…so unreal.
Jai kept holding Bani in his arms, with strength and with gentleness….and then almost as if in a whisper he said, “Who told you that I like Roshni?”
Bani made no reply as she was held in Jai’s arms and looked dazed and overcome by her emotions and then after a moment’s silence answered hesitatingly, “I saw you both in the same room… I saw her with you …she was with you in the room…in the bed.”
Bani now sounded unsure of herself, as the fogginess in her head seemed to hit her senses as she placed her hands on Jai’s chest as if to balance herself from falling down. Jai let out a faint smile and then as he realized what Bani was saying, his smile widened a little bit more till it almost became a soft laughter and he shaked his head gently and answered back, “I have no idea what you are talking about or what you have seen. But nothing happened between me and Roshni. I went to her room and came back as it is. Please trust me.”
Bani looked astonished as she kept staring into Jai’s deep brown eyes and before she could react further, he came closer and with great tenderness planted a kiss on the nape of Bani’s neck and gently shaking her silky hair with his fingers and holding her face close to his own, he closed his eyes as he kissed Bani, with a passion and feeling that he had buried in his heart for the past so many days….it seemed like time froze in an instant and as the tears kept flowing involuntarily from Bani’s eyes, Jai kissed off a droplet from her cheeks, as Bani tingled to the core of her self with Jai’s mesmerizing touch.
Jai lifted Bani deftly in his arms and without as much as a single word, led her towards their bed…..
Bani did not know what made her fall into Jai’s arms with an effortlessness and relief that had previously never existed in their relationship…for Bani it seemed, that this was the most natural progression to their relationship and even in her semi-conscious condition, all Bani could realize was that from now onwards, she never wanted to leave the warmth and protection of Jai’s arms, not tonight and not forever…
Back to the Present
‘Suniye…Suniye…Mr. Walia…’ her soft voice interrupted her thoughts and he looked at her completely dazed.
‘Rano said you were here…I looked for you all over the house…and then I came to this room…’
Jai kept gazing at Bani, her skin pallor had improved and a tinge of rosiness spotted her cheeks, her eyes were just as bright and shining as they had always been…and he saw that one of her hand was covered in Mehendi, up till her elbows.
Feeling extremely shy at the manner in which he was staring at her, she dropped her eyelids and avoided looking at him.
‘I have got you something, I want you to wear when we get married, Bani.’
She raised her eyes and looked at him wonderingly, till he put his hands in his pockets and took out a pair of exquisitely crafted bangles…recognizing them immediatlely, Bani couldn’t help but get her eyes moist.
When she took them slowly from his hands, she asked him in a timid, overpowered voice, ‘Are they for me?’
Jai couldn’t help laughing out loud and he repeated the same words that he had once used for a very similar occasion, ‘No…its for me…I have actually started wearing Bangles.’
Flushing deeply and overwhelmed by sentiments, Bani broke down crying gently, with her head buried in his chest.
He let her cry for sometime and then lifting her head, looked at her face and whispered in a specious tone, ‘Don’t come too near me…I have just had a very vivid journey back the memory lane and you are tempting me to repeat history once again right now…’
Before Bani could understand what he was trying to say, Rano had knoced on the door and putting only her head in spoke mischievously, ‘Meeting time over…Di, please come out before Massi or Daadi see both of you and Mr. Walia, Tarunji is looking for you all over the place and creating a big ruckus.’
Bani all but ran out of the room, clutching the Kangans, while Jai muttered something about Tarun being the death of him someday and got out of the room, locking it, to be opened now on only on his wedding night.

Part
4 A
The wedding day began at 6 in the morning with Massi initiating Lord Ganesha’s name and prayed to ward off all evils so that the ceremony is a success and bless the couple for lifelong happiness and love.
Bani had got up early and changed into a simple sari for the Ganesh Pooja, but her face glowed so much that in spite of feeling extremely emotional, Rano couldn’t help teasing her sister alongside Raashi.
The gathering numbered to some 50 odd people and since everyone was part of the family, there was much chit chatter going on. Bani sat in front of the mirror, slightly nervous as Raashi, Rano and Jai’s cousin, Karuna helped get her dressed for the ceremony.
Bani’s wedding Sari looked exquisitely beautiful, done in deep red and green, both colors of auspiciousness and all the jewels she was going to wear was a gift from Jai, which had once belonged to his Mother. All the three women were gushing over the elaborate work on the Kundan set that Bani was going to wear, when Rano noticed the look of sadness in Bani’s eyes. Taking the opportunity of seeing Raashi and Karuna engaged in a conversation over the wedding, Rano came near Bani and sitting besides her, spoke softly, ‘What happened Di? Why do you look so sad? And that too today?’
The tears that had stopped itself in her eyes spilled gently on her cheeks and the only word she said was, ‘Pia.’
Rano closed her eyes in exasperation and answered back, ‘Oh God di…when will you understand? Its best that Pia is not here…and if you take my advice, please keep her out of your and Mr. Walia’s life from today onwards…You…you have no idea what she was trying to do when you had left this house…’
Rano continued, not really wanting to say these things, but not wanting to keep her sister in the dark any longer. ‘Di…Pia still thinks that there is nothing between you and Mr. Walia…that you both don’t love each other…and that she made a mistake in leaving him…she…she tried to come back to his life…I saw all her shameless attempts…the very fact that she continued living here after you had gone away proves that her intentions were wrong.’
Sensing Bani’s complete silence on the issue, Rano said hurriedly, ‘Don’t get me wrong…Mr. Walia did not for once encourage her in any way…he was always such a gentleman…he could have got her thrown away from his house easily…but just for your sake…knowing that your happiness was in me and Pia…he let her stay in this house…it was only till I had a huge fight with her one day that she walked out from here…but I know that she still harbors a hope of getting the place that is only yours for keeping.’
They both plunged in silence till Bani spoke quietly, ‘That was only because Pia did not know the truth about Mr. Walia and me…if I had told her even once that I loved my husband, she would have done everything she could to save my marriage.’
Rano looked on disbelievingly and said, ‘You really believe that, Di? Pia is the same girl who left you to face everyone’s anger and hatred…and now she doesn’t even have that marriage for which she trampled upon Mr. Walia’s heart and put our life’s to hold.’
Bani spoke gently, wiping her tears, ‘Everyone makes mistakes, Rano…you, me, Mr. Walia…and if we can be forgiven, then why should Pia be the exception…as far as her intentions regarding Mr. Walia goes…I don’t know what she feels about him…or whether she ever held any feelings for him in the first place…all I know is that I love that man to death and I will do what I can to give him every happiness on Earth…and now I know that his happiness come from me…so if you are thinking that I am going to throw away my marriage for my sister’s sake, you are wrong.’
Rano looked amazed and said, ‘Di…I just thought if you could step in to take her place with Mr. Walia, then…’
Bani smiled faintly and added, ‘Then, I could step back and give Pia back her place? There is a whole world’s difference between making our choices and then giving up on what we have already chosen. When we decide on something, we take a risk into the unknown…and when we have made that decision…then it becomes our destiny. We can chose our paths, Rano…but we cannot alter the course of our journey afterwards.’
There was a stunned silence from Rano, till she gave an affectionate smile and said, ‘Now I know why you and Jeeju belong came back to each other...before you, only his heart had been captured...but when you became a part of his life, you won over his soul, di!’
‘Kya baatein ho rahin hain, dono behnon mein?’ Massi had just entered, bringing with her a silver thaali which held a Mangalsutra and a box of vermillion. Bani wiped her eyes and touched Massi’s feet to be blessed by her and then started getting dressed.
Jai had arrived at Walia Mansion along with Tarun and the sounds of laughter were coming upto Bani’s room, making her blush even more. Rano and the others had gone downstairs, leaving Bani on her own for some time before the ceremony begun. Bedecked in shades of crimson and green, she made a striking picture of beauty and serenity, as she found herself staring back at her reflection. Her thoughts were broken when she saw Pia standing behind her, looking at Bani through the mirror.
Stunned Bani turned to face her sister and whispered, ‘Pia…you came?’
Tears streamed down Pia’s face, when she bent down to sit on the floor and taking Bani’s palms in her own, said, ‘I missed your wedding last time…how could I do it again, Di?’
In between smiles and tears, both the sisters hugged, till Rano came rushing by to get Bani downstairs and kept standing at the door, looking at both her elder sisters.
Pia noticed Rano and giving a watery smile said, ‘Agreed, that we have never been the best of friends, Rano…but today let us make up like old times…for Bani di’s happiness.’
Crying like a child, Rano rushed towards both her sisters and Bani enveloped Rano and Pia in her arms. Wiping her tears, Bani looked towards Pia and Rano and said, ‘We are all a part of each other’s lifes…and whatever happens in the future, we can never be cut off from one another…our hearts will always belong together.’
Dressed in a simple Black Sherwani, with his hair pulled back neatly and accessorized with just his signature watch, Jai looked so handsome that Bani couldn’t help staring at him, till he looked back at her, making her flush severely and immediately put her head down. Jai couldn’t resist quipping at her when she was made to sit down besides him in the Lagan Vedi, ‘You weren’t asleep that night when I came in late. You were just pretending to be asleep, right?’
At first Bani couldn’t comprehend what he had just said, but when she did, the smile refused to go off her face.
With the priest chanting invocations, he called upon the groom’s and bride’s sister to come forward and tie the gathbandhan. Both Jigyasa and Pia looked at each other silently and in that one moment, realized how much their selfishness and recklessness had ended up giving untold grief and hurt to the two people whom they loved the most in the world.
Quietly they both stepped forward and taking a silent personal vow to never become the reason of Jai and Bani’s unhappiness again, tied the ends of Jai’s safa with Bani’s sari.
The marriage ceremony ended with Jai dipping his finger ring in the pot of vermillion and smearing it across Bani’s forehead.
‘Vivah sampan hua…ab aap pati aur patni hain.’ Finished the priest, and everyone had just begun congratulation the couple, when Tarun quipped, ‘Eureka Panditji…this is one thing that none of us knew…Jai and Bani are a couple!’
Jai began laughing along with everyone and retorted back, ‘Massi, please make sure this man doesn’t stay back for the post-marriage dinner tonight.’
Tarun replied back by saying that the only way he could be made to miss the post-marriage dinner was by getting him forcibly thrown out of Walia Mansion and he knew that Bani would never let Jai get away with that, after all he was her once upon a time lawyer.
Part 4 B
The dinner finished and everyone assembled in the living room, when Jai kept looking at his watch, hoping that someone would take the hint and excuse both him and Bani as early as possible. But with Tarun and Aditya around, it looked impossible for some time at least! Tarun had arranged for a game to play and despite Jai’s protests, ended up agreeing him and Bani to play.
Tarun cleared his voice dramatically and announced the rules of the game, ‘Well as it goes…Adi and I have come up with a list of questions which we will ask Jai and his much better half, Bani…to see how much they know each other!’
Smiling flirtatiously at a very shy looking Bani, Tarun said sweetly, ‘Bani, being the lovely lady that you are, the first question is for you. What is Jai’s favorite color?’
Everyone looked towards Bani and Jai felt confident that she could never guess it in one go, since he did not ever remember mentioning such a thing to her, but without missing a beat, she answered back softly, ‘Black.’
Tarun gave an approving look back at the paper he was holding and said, ‘That’s bang on target! Well done! Jai, you have a tough act to follow, since your wife has started out so well!’
Turning to look comically at a confident looking Jai, he said, ‘Okay Jai, now your turn. Tell us Bani’s favorite color?’
Jai arched his eyebrows and looked a bit embarrassed now till Rano, not able to withhold her laughter at the predicament his brother-in-law was facing, helped him out. ‘Jeeju…I will give you a hint…it starts with the letter P.’
Jai smiled and said, ‘I knew it…Its purple.’
Everyone looked towards Tarun and Rano and they both burst out laughing and yelled, ‘Wrong…’
‘Is it Puce?’ and the added wildly, ‘Pomegranate Red?’
Tarun almost doubled with laughter and said, ‘Pomegranate Red? Kya baat hain, genius.’
Rano hit her head and laughingly said, ‘Its Pink.’
Jai looked stupefied and remembered how once he had selected a Pink colored Sari for her and she had told him that it was her favorite color.
‘Bani, its your turn and I know you will outdo this duffer easily.’
‘Hey, whom are you calling a duffer?’ retorted back an amused Jai.
‘Tujhe hi bula raha hoon, Mr. Pomegranate Red.’
Everyone burst out laughing uncontrollably at Tarun’s humor.
‘Bani, this one might be slightly tough…but lets see if you can give it a try. If you can answer even 3 out of 5, you win this round. How many colors of shirt does Jai have?’
Nachiket grinned and said, ‘Come on Tarunji, this is too tough…how can Bhabhi remember Jai Bhaiyaa’s shirt color?’
Before Tarun could answer him back, Bani spoke in her subdued, soft voice, ‘7 Whites, 5 Oxford Blues, 7 Blacks, 3 Grey’s and 2 Khakhi colored.’
Everyone stared at Bani, stunned and she felt so embarrassed, that she refused to look up, twiddling the edge of her Sari.
Till Tarun started clapping and said, ‘Bravo…Well done Bani’ and then looking at a flabbergasted looking Jai said, ‘Learn something! Pomegranate Red indeed.’
When the jovial laughter had died down, Tarun took the paper in his hand and coughing in an exaggerated manner addressed Jai, ‘Now is your chance for redemption…tell us what is Bani’s favorite dish?’
Looking like a fish out of water, Jai hazarded a guess, ‘Um…is it Chicken Tikka?’ and then looking at the expression on Bani’s face, he hastily added, ‘Or some Chicken dish…definitely…’
Tarun grinned like a monkey and said, ‘Wrong my dear friend…it’s neither Chicken Tikka or any dish related to the feathered species…’
Rano added not able to hide her smile at Jai’s complete lack of knowledge in regard to Bani and said, ‘Jeejaji…don’t you know, Bani di is a vegetarian. And she likes Paneer Kofta the most.’
All that Jai could say was, ‘Oh…’
Tarun turned to look at Bani and said, ‘I have given up all hopes on your husband, now you answer me. What is the one dish that Jai hates the most and would never eat knowingly?’
She added quietly, with a smile on her lips, ‘Methi Palak.’
‘Correct again! Clap for the lady!’ Tarun yelped till Jai said in an agitated voice, ‘But I ate Methi Palak once…’
The usually quiet Ranveer chipped in, ‘Only because you didn’t realize the taste of the dish till you were told about it…she cooked it so well.’
Rano gave an appreciative look at Ranveer and wondered when he would get over his ‘Bramhachari’ nonsense once and for all.
‘Alright, Jai one last question for you…salvage your fast sinking reputation by this one…’
Jai interrupted Tarun and looking at Bani, smiled and said, ‘Let her ask the last question.’
A collective sigh went around the room, making Bani blush furiously and after much prodding and instigation, she managed to look up at Jai and spoke with extreme shyness, ‘I have no question to ask…’
‘Oh come on Bhabhi…yahi mauka hain! You have to make Bhaiyaa do something atleast.’ A chorus of approval went around and Jai shrugged his hands across to Bani, indicating that there was no other way of escape.
She spoke shyly, almost inaudible, ‘Then please tell him to sing a song…’
Aditya immediately yelled out, ‘Oh No…torture…Bani, what did you ask him to do? Did you forget the last time Jai took on the mike? My ears still sting.’
There were wild guffaws and Jai kept refusing to sing, till Bani looked up at him and spoke softly, ‘Gayie na…’
Tarun said, ‘Uff…Bani, if you speak so sweetly, not only will be sing, he might dance for you too…’
Jai went, ‘Oh God, you guys…’
Aditya and Tarun immediately begged him to sing, ‘Promise, we won’t laugh Jai…just make sure we get the medical insurance for our ears!’
Laughter followed and a very awkward looking Jai complied for Bani and sang a tuneless but heart-rending version of, ‘Tujhe dekh dekh sona…’
Bani started clapping first and the loudest and kept clapping till Tarun, Nachiket and Aditya started teasing her mercilessly for listening to Jai in such a mesmerized manner.
Jai looked around for some way of escaping to his bedroom, as the clock ticked by and it was Massi to the rescue once again as she rubbed Jai’s hair and remarked to Tarun in a crossed manner, ‘Kyon mere Munna ke peeche pade ho? Its almost 11, and both of them look so tired…let them go now.’
Tarun coughed deliberately and said, ‘Of course…when did I stop him?’
Laughter followed and Bani was taken to the bedroom by a quiet yet happy Pia, Rano and Raashi, who kept giggling and making Bani feel more bashful than ever before.
Before they left the room, Pia stopped and turning to face her sister sitting in the flower bedecked bed, held her hand and spoke emotionally, ‘I wish you and Mr. Walia every happiness in the world, Di…no one deserves to be with him more than you and no one needs you more than Mr. Walia does…keep smiling like this always.’
Bani’s eyes moistened and they both hugged one another warmly.
Part 4 C
Jai was about to enter his bedroom, when Nachiket came from behind and hesitating a bit, spoke up, ‘Bhaiyya…shall we go?’
Looking bewildered, Jai answered back, ‘Go where?’
Nachiket replied in the same serious tone, ‘To the study…the conference call is about to begin?’
Completely at sea, Jai said, ‘What conference call are you talking about Nachiket? And this time of the hour?’
‘Yes Bhaiyya…the concall with Mr. McWilliams and his team…and this hour is perfect…since its just struck 9 am in New York…’
Looking astounded, Jai said, ‘You kept a conference call with the client for tonight?’
Nachiket, giving an innocent air of one who has no idea about anything said, ‘Yes, isn’t it great? Ranveer and I were finding it so difficult to get a convenient time slot and Mr. McWilliams finally agreed for tonight…it won’t be long I guess…just 3 or 4 hours at the max.’
Jai spoke slowly, ‘It would get over at 3 in the morning?’
Nachiket replied back, ‘Yes…but incase they want to discuss some additional points, it might get stretched up till 4 too…but not later than that, I guess.’
Looking trapped and dazed, Jai said, ‘So I have to come NOW?’
Getting a sweet smile on his face, Nachiket said, ‘If you start walking to the study now, we would be able to join Ranveer and the others in 5 minutes. Chale?’
Jai stood at the door, stumped, wondering what was happening and then shrugging off his head, spoke in a despondent voice, ‘Okay…I’ll just tell Bani to go off to sleep…’
Nachiket could contain no longer and in-between a flurry of apologies and laughter confessed that they were just playing a prank on Jai.
When Jai held Nachiket’s neck in the grip of his fingers, he squealed and yelped between laughing out, ‘It was Tarun and Adityaji’s idea, Bhaiyya…I was just made the scapegoat…honest, Bhaiyaa…Ouch…that hurt.’
‘Its going to hurt further…you brat!’ Jai laughed when Tarun and Aditya joined in.
‘Tarun, tu sudharega nahin…and Adi, you too?’
Adi flayed his hands and said, ‘Kya karoon? The last time you got married, you sent off poor Bani packing from your room…so I just felt that the roles had to be reversed this time…but this Nachiket couldn’t continue our drama!’
Tarun added, ‘And we just wanted Bani to have that extra time for the idea to sink in that she is one of the lucky ones to be married twice in one life…but unfortunately to the same person, twice over.’
Everyone began laughing and Jai said, ‘unfortunately, ah?’
Tarun and Aditya suddenly went emotional and said, ‘Nahin yaar…we are just really happy for both of you…so happy, that its becoming tough to hold back our emotions and tears…that is why we are trying to pull your leg…you know, guys are not supposed to cry and all in such occasions!’
Jai grinned at his two best friends and bear hugged them both, followed by Nachiket and Ranveer and finally got to his room, securely locking the door from inside, not wanting to risk any of Aditya or Tarun’s pranks on him and Bani anymore.
Jai found Bani standing near the huge French window of their bedroom, staring at the full moon that had alighted everything in the sky.
‘Did the moon tell you how jealous it is tonight?’ Taken aback at his sudden arrival, Bani turned to face him, only till she saw the look of passionate love in his deep, dark eyes and blushed profusely, followed by lowering her face.
Lifting her chin delicately, Jai looked into her lowered eyes and said, ‘I wish I had a way around words….and I could tell you what this night means to me…what being with you means to me…what having you in my life once again means to me.’
Bani looked up at him and finally finding a voice said softly, ‘I never needed words to understand you feelings…they just came to me on its own.’
They kept staring at one another, till Bani noticed with shock that Jai’s eyes had moistened a bit and keeping her henna clad palms on his cheeks, she said, ‘Tears?’
He replied back quietly, ‘When there is so much happiness, the only way to let some out is through them…’
Without any other word, he clasped her bangle laden hands and pulled her towards himself, drawing her in a warm embrace and beginning the endless night with a deep, passionate kiss.
It was the start of a new life…yet the continuation of a love for which fate had chosen Jai and Bani.
